All beginner students are taught grooming techniques, the basics of tack and how to tack up a horse. Students are also taught horse psychology and veterinary care.

Riders progress at their own pace.

This is great training for students who have a goal of owning their own horse.

A beginner lesson might include:

  • grooming techniques
  • tacking up your horse
  • steering your horse
  • walking, rising and sitting trot
  • basic jump position
  • trotting poles
  • riding circles, loops, straight lines

A novice or intermediate lesson might include:

  • riding a basic level dressage test
  • jumping cross rails and small fences
  • negotiating a hunter/jumper course
  • standard first aid of horses
  • in depth tack knowledge
  • basic lunging and long line techniques

An advanced lesson might include:

  • advanced jumping skills
  • executing training level dressage test
  • extensive work without stirrups
  • advanced lunge line and long line techniques
  • actively involved in backing and training upcoming horses and ponies
  • course design

At Hunter Green we will match you to one of our lesson horses or ponies that suits your needs and riding ability. Once we determine the appropriate match, we will often schedule your lessons on the same horse or pony. This allows you to get to know your mount and to bond with them.

Actual lesson length is based on the number of students in the class.
Number of Students
in Class
Approximate Lesson Length
1 30 minutes
2 to 3 45 minutes
4 to 5 1 hour

6 Month "Better Than Part-Board" Program

**NEW** - Hunter Green now offer a 6 month program with lessons and practice rides.

Why do we say this program is "Better Than Part-Boarding"?
We match you with a suitable horse or pony and schedule your lessons and practice rides on that horse or pony. You will get to know them and love them, but in the event that they cannot be ridden due to illness or injury, you can take your lesson on another horse/pony. This is a benefit over traditional part-boarding or quarter-boarding where you would only be able to ride your part-boarded horse.
